Guava Nectar is the more energy-dense option here, packing 42 more calories per 100g than Classic Roast.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.
However, watch out for the sugar content. Guava Nectar contains significantly more sugar (9.55g) compared to the milder Classic Roast (0g). If you are monitoring your insulin levels or trying to cut down on sweets, Classic Roast is undeniably the healthier pick.
